Cam bearings are cylindrical sleeves that support the camshaft as it rotates. Precision-engineered to specific tolerances, they ensure the camshaft's stability, minimize friction, and prevent excessive wear. When cam bearings fail or become misaligned, it can lead to premature camshaft and engine damage.

Step 1: Preparing the Engine Block
Thoroughly clean the engine block surface where the cam bearings will be installed. Remove any dirt, debris, or oil residue using a degreaser and a clean cloth.
Step 2: Measuring Cam Bearing Bores
Using measuring calipers, check the diameter of the cam bearing bores to ensure they meet specifications. Worn or out-of-tolerance bores may require machining or honing.
Step 3: Removing Old Cam Bearings
Insert the cam bearing removal tool into the bearing bore and carefully tap the bearing out of the block. Repeat this process for all cam bearing locations.
Step 4: Installing New Cam Bearings
Apply a thin layer of engine oil to the outer surface of the cam bearing. Insert the cam bearing installation tool over the bearing and gently tap it into the bore. Ensure that the bearing is installed flush with the block surface.
Step 5: Checking Bearing Alignment
Once all cam bearings are installed, use the cam bearing installation tool to check their alignment. Rotate the tool to verify that the bearings are centered and running true.
